Persistent molecular remission of refractory acute myeloid leukemia with inv(16)(p13.1q22) in an elderly patient induced by cytarabine ocfosfate hydrate.

Abstract
The prognosis of relapsed acute myeloid leukemia (AML) in elderly patients is dismal, even if the AML exhibits a good prognostic karyotype, such as inv(16)(p13.1q22). We present a 72-year-old female with AML with inv(16)(p13.1q22) who suffered five episodes of relapse with temporary complete remission. Maintenance chemotherapy with oral cytarabine ocfosfate hydrate eventually produced persistent molecular complete remission of her AML that had not been induced by conventional regimens including intensive chemotherapy and low dose cytarabine therapy. The high level of tolerability to oral cytarabine ocfosfate hydrate may offer elderly patients with this type of AML a good chance for a cure.
